Introduction to TPMS
TPMS is an electronic system designed to monitor the air pressure inside a vehicle’s tires. It alerts the driver if the pressure drops below a certain threshold, which can be critical for preventing accidents caused by underinflated tires. The system typically consists of sensors mounted on each wheel, a central control unit, and a display on the dashboard. There are two main types of TPMS: direct and indirect. Direct TPMS uses physical sensors inside each tire to measure pressure, while indirect TPMS estimates pressure by monitoring the rotation speed of each wheel, comparing it to a baseline established when the tires were properly inflated.
Importance of TPMS
The TPMS is crucial for several reasons:
– Safety: Underinflated tires can lead to reduced traction, increased stopping distance, and a higher risk of tire failure, which can result in accidents.
– Fuel Efficiency: Properly inflated tires can improve fuel efficiency, as underinflated tires create more rolling resistance.
– Tire Longevity: Maintaining the correct tire pressure can extend the life of the tires, as underinflation can lead to uneven wear and premature failure.
The TPMS Reset Button: Functionality and Purpose
The TPMS reset button is used to recalibrate the system after certain events, such as changing tire pressure, replacing a tire, or installing new TPMS sensors. This process ensures that the system provides accurate readings and warnings based on the current tire conditions. However, the presence and location of this button can vary significantly between different car models.
Variations in TPMS Reset Buttons
Not all vehicles have a dedicated TPMS reset button. The method for resetting the TPMS can differ, and some models might require a specific sequence of actions or even a visit to a dealership or a repair shop for reinitialization. Common methods for resetting TPMS include:
– Using a dedicated button, often located on the dashboard, under the steering column, or on the center console.
– Following a specific procedure outlined in the vehicle’s manual, which might involve driving the vehicle at a certain speed for a few minutes after setting the recommended tire pressure.
– Utilizing a TPMS relearn tool, especially for vehicles that do not have a straightforward reset process.

Resetting TPMS: A Step-by-Step Guide
Although the exact steps can vary, here’s a general overview of how to reset the TPMS in many vehicles:
- Ensure the vehicle is in a safe location and apply the parking brake.
- Turn the ignition switch to the “ON” position but do not start the engine.
- Locate the TPMS reset button, which is usually found on the steering column, on the center console, or under the dashboard.
- Press and hold the reset button until the TPMS light blinks (this may take a few seconds).
- Release the button and then press it again. The light should stay on for a few seconds and then turn off, indicating the system has been reset.

How do I know if my car has a TPMS system?
If you are unsure whether your car has a TPMS system, you can check the owner’s manual or look for a TPMS warning light on the dashboard. Most vehicles with a TPMS system have a warning light that illuminates when the system detects a problem with the tire pressure. You can also check the vehicle’s specifications or consult with a dealership or certified mechanic to determine if your vehicle is equipped with a TPMS system. Additionally, you can check the tires and wheels for TPMS sensors, which are usually marked with a TPMS logo or a series of letters and numbers.
The TPMS system is a mandatory safety feature in many countries, including the United States, where it has been required on all new vehicles since 2007. As a result, most modern vehicles are equipped with a TPMS system. However, some older vehicles may not have a TPMS system, or it may have been installed as an optional feature. How often should I check my tire pressure, and what is the recommended pressure for my vehicle?
You should check your tire pressure at least once a month, and before long trips or when driving in extreme weather conditions. The recommended tire pressure for your vehicle can be found on the tire information placard, which is usually located on the driver’s side doorjamb, inside the fuel filler door, or on the inside of the trunk lid. It is essential to use the recommended tire pressure, as underinflated or overinflated tires can affect the vehicle’s safety, performance, and fuel efficiency.
The recommended tire pressure may vary depending on the vehicle load, driving conditions, and weather. For example, if you are carrying a heavy load or driving in extreme temperatures, you may need to adjust the tire pressure accordingly. It is also important to note that tire pressure can change over time due to natural leakage, and it may need to be adjusted periodically to maintain the recommended pressure.
